What It Carries

The anterior spinothalamic tract transmits crude (non-discriminative) touch and pressure sensations. It is distinct from the lateral spinothalamic tract (pain and temperature) but both travel together in the anterolateral system (anterolateral fasciculus/funiculus).

The Three-Neuron Arc

NeuronLocationDetails
1st orderDorsal root ganglionPeripheral receptor → enters spinal cord via dorsal root
2nd orderDorsal horn (laminae IV-V mainly)Cell body in posterior gray; axon crosses midline
3rd orderVPL nucleus of thalamusProjects to primary somatosensory cortex (postcentral gyrus, areas 3, 1, 2)

Pathway in Detail

  1. Entry: First-order axons (carrying crude touch/pressure) enter the cord via the dorsal root entry zone.
  2. Synapse in dorsal horn: They synapse on second-order neurons primarily in laminae IV and V of the dorsal horn.
  3. Decussation: Second-order axons cross the midline in the anterior white commissure (ventral commissure). Importantly, this crossing takes 2-3 spinal segments to complete - so a cord lesion affects contralateral sensation beginning 2-3 levels below the lesion.
  4. Ascent: Crossed fibers ascend in the anterolateral white matter on the opposite side.
  5. Somatotopic organization: As fibers from successively higher levels join the tract medially, the sacral/lower limb fibers lie most laterally (superficially), and cervical/upper limb fibers lie more medially. This explains the phenomenon of "sacral sparing" in central cord lesions.
  6. Brainstem course: At the medulla, the tract runs laterally between the inferior olive and inferior cerebellar peduncle. In the pons and midbrain, it lies just lateral to the medial lemniscus.
  7. Thalamic relay: Terminates in the VPL (ventral posterolateral) nucleus of the thalamus.
  8. Cortex: Via thalamic somatosensory radiations through the internal capsule → postcentral gyrus (primary somatosensory cortex).

Anterolateral System - Three Tracts

The anterior spinothalamic tract is one of three tracts in the anterolateral system:
TractFunctionThalamic Terminus
SpinothalamicDiscriminative pain, temperature, crude touchVPL nucleus
SpinoreticularEmotional/arousal aspects of pain; diffuse visceral painIntralaminar nuclei (centromedian) via brainstem reticular formation
SpinomesencephalicPain modulation; connects to PAG and parabrachial nucleiMidbrain structures

Anterior vs. Lateral Spinothalamic Tract

FeatureAnterior (Ventral)Lateral
ModalityCrude touch, pressurePain, temperature
Location in cordAnterior funiculusLateral funiculus
DecussationAnterior white commissureAnterior white commissure
Clinical lesionTouch may be preserved (bilateral input)Contralateral loss below lesion
Key clinical note: Unlike the lateral spinothalamic (pain/temp), crude touch carried by the anterior spinothalamic tract has some representation via both the ipsilateral posterior column and contralateral spinothalamic tract. So a unilateral cord lesion may only mildly impair crude touch, but completely abolish pain/temp on the contralateral side - the basis of Brown-Sequard syndrome.

Clinical Correlation - Brown-Sequard Syndrome

In a hemisection of the spinal cord:
  • Ipsilateral: Loss of fine touch, proprioception (posterior column)
  • Contralateral: Loss of pain and temperature starting 2-3 levels below (lateral spinothalamic)
  • Crude touch: Often relatively preserved bilaterally due to dual pathways
